Be prepared for what’s ahead with the DROID Command Center widget, your control center for date and time, weather, battery status, and frequently accessed settings. Set an alarm from the time circle. Add cities to the weather circle. View battery status and access power-saving settings from the battery circle. Flip the time circle for quick control of media sharing apps, or flip the battery circle for a shortcut to general phone settings.
